who does mia goth play in frankenstein

Mia Goth plays two characters in Guillermo del Toro’s Frankenstein : Elizabeth (Victor Frankenstein’s beloved) and Victor’s mother.

Main roles she plays

  • Elizabeth Lavenza, Victor Frankenstein’s great love and central emotional anchor of the story.
  • Victor Frankenstein’s mother, creating a deliberate “mother/lover” duality in the film’s psychology and themes.

Why this dual casting matters

  • The casting choice is described as an intentional way to underline Victor’s emotional dependence and blurred boundaries between maternal comfort and romantic desire.
  • Cast and commentators note that it adds a strange, unsettling layer that fits del Toro’s darker, more psychological take on Frankenstein.

Quick context for the movie

  • The film is Guillermo del Toro’s reimagining of Mary Shelley’s Frankenstein , released on Netflix with Jacob Elordi as the Creature and Oscar Isaac as Victor Frankenstein.
  • Mia Goth’s Elizabeth is often highlighted in interviews and features as one of the standout performances and a key to the film’s emotional “heart.”
